Pablo Neruda was a Chilean writer famous for his love poetry. He was also a diplomat who died just days after a government coup. Correspondent Joel Richards reports on the mysterious death of this literary legend.

Earlier this year, Neruda’s body was buried for a fourth time. The Chilean Nobel Literature Prize winner was as well known for his poetry as he was for his politics. Neruda was a member of the Communist Party and an adviser to former president Salvador Allende who died during a coup in 1973.

When Neruda himself passed away shortly thereafter, it was widely understood to be from cancer. But, many believe it was from something more sinister.

A recent investigation looked into the true cause of his death.
